What is a cross dock LTL terminal?
The critical difference is that in a cross dock terminal/warehouse the floor level/elevation is 4 feet above ground level.
Most commercial trucks' and trailers' floor level is also 4 feet off the ground.
This means that freight moved by forklift or pallet jack or fridge dolly can be quickly and safely moved from or to a truck or trailer and other trucks or trailers parked against the cross dock terminal
And usually cross dock terminals have built in dock plates that form a bridge between the truck and the terminal for smooth safe movement between the truck/trailer and the building
